Xbox SmartGlass – The 360 Entertainment Center for Your Android

  The Xbox SmartGlass is a second-screen app built to integrate your Xbox 360 with your Android device. This cross-platform initiative allows you to manage and control content from your gaming console on your Android device with one-touch access, for example –configuring a touch controller to browse the internet, manage music files, etc. SmartGlass is a great family-friendly app that aims to turn your Android into a complete media entertainment center by bringing the amazing…

How to get SmartGlass on your Android

Microsoft has been on a tear over the last few months with its Windows 8 marketing. And one of the most popular features of the Windows 8 “revolution” is SmartGlass, an app that allows users to learn more information about TV shows and movies while they’re watching. Basically, SmartGlass allows your smartphone or tablet to function as a separate screen while you’re using the Xbox 360.
